She wore herself out in about five minutes.
Yes, she seemed to be doing a lot of smiling while doing those zoomies and getting a tickle from mom. She is such a delightful little girl. Next for her is a spay, but will wait till she's six months old first, and also have her chipped while she's under. (two more months) She will continue being in her little fence, but will be put outside about every hour or so to play and potty. She always stays on the sofa with us in the evening and doesn't even try to jump down, yet at least. She will also get to walk around the house with harness and leash on a few minutes several times a day to get used to the leash and the house and also get house trained. She has never failed to use the wee-wee pad while in her pen and now she's doing her potty outside too with tons of praise. She dearly LOVES getting the kisses after a potty, and now even if her back is to me when she goes, she always turns to see if I'm watching. When I say "good potty" Libby, her ears lay back and she flies to me with the bigest smile, for kisses and more praise.
